For all the fire and fury, what actually happened this financial week?
If you were gone for the financial week on vacation, you might look at the S&P 500 and think that it was a quiet week in the market. The index is pretty much exactly where it was on Friday August 2. But did you know that the Dow Industrials were down over 750 points on Monday? What happened?
Monday’s downdraft was due to China allowing their currency to depreciate against the U.S. Dollar. China controls their currency, and their move was seen as an escalation of the simmering U.S.-China trade dispute. As it turns out, China backed off and allowed their currency to return to more normal levels.
This week’s action is a classic example of why it’s not a good idea to watch the market tick-by-tick. It’s always moving up and down – sometimes a lot. By keeping a long-term focus, you’ll avoid having your emotions whipped around by a stock market index!
